SQLite数据库是一款轻量级的、开源的、嵌入式的关系型数据库管理系统,广泛应用于移动设备,尤其是在Android平台上。它具有体积小、效率高、无需额外配置等特点,使得它在Android开发中具有神奇...
SQLite数据库是一款轻量级的、开源的、嵌入式的关系型数据库管理系统,广泛应用于移动设备,尤其是在Android平台上。它具有体积小、效率高、无需额外配置等特点,使得它在Android开发中具有神奇的应用。
以下是一个简单的示例,展示了如何在Android应用中使用SQLite数据库:
import android.content.Context;
import android.database.sqlite.SQLiteDatabase;
import android.database.sqlite.SQLiteOpenHelper;
public class DatabaseHelper extends SQLiteOpenHelper { private static final String DATABASE_NAME = "mydatabase.db"; private static final int DATABASE_VERSION = 1; public DatabaseHelper(Context context) { super(context, DATABASE_NAME, null, DATABASE_VERSION); } @Override public void onCreate(SQLiteDatabase db) { String CREATE_TABLE = "CREATE TABLE users (id INTEGER PRIMARY KEY, name TEXT, age INTEGER)"; db.execSQL(CREATE_TABLE); } @Override public void onUpgrade(SQLiteDatabase db, int oldVersion, int newVersion) { // Handle database version upgrades here }
}在上面的示例中,我们创建了一个名为DatabaseHelper的类,它继承自SQLiteOpenHelper。在onCreate方法中,我们使用SQL语句创建了一个名为users的表,包含id、name和age三个字段。
SQLite数据库在Android开发中具有神奇的应用,它为开发者提供了方便、高效的数据存储和管理方案。通过熟练掌握SQLite数据库的使用,开发者可以更好地实现Android应用的功能。